Product Management Analytics Question: Evaluating metrics for ClassPass live-streamed fitness classes

Introduction

Evaluating ClassPass's live-streamed fitness classes requires a comprehensive approach to product success metrics. To address this challenge effectively, I'll follow a structured framework that covers core metrics, supporting indicators, and risk factors while considering all key stakeholders. This approach will help us understand the performance of live-streamed classes and guide strategic decisions for improvement.

Framework Overview

I'll follow a simple success metrics framework covering product context, success metrics hierarchy, and strategic initiatives.

Step 1

Product Context

ClassPass's live-streamed fitness classes are a digital offering that allows users to participate in real-time workout sessions from home. Key stakeholders include:

  1. Users: Seeking convenient, high-quality fitness experiences
  2. Fitness instructors: Looking to reach a broader audience and maintain income
  3. ClassPass: Aiming to expand its user base and increase engagement
  4. Gym partners: Wanting to maintain visibility and revenue streams

User flow:

  1. Browse available classes
  2. Book a class
  3. Join the live stream at the scheduled time
  4. Participate in the workout
  5. Provide feedback or ratings post-class

This feature aligns with ClassPass's strategy to provide flexible fitness options and adapt to changing consumer preferences, especially in light of the shift towards at-home workouts. Compared to competitors like Peloton or Mirror, ClassPass offers a wider variety of class types without requiring specific equipment purchases.

In terms of product lifecycle, live-streamed classes are likely in the growth stage, with increasing adoption but room for optimization and expansion.
